Beginning inventory
The value of a company's inventory at the start of an accounting period.
Perpetual inventory system
An inventory system that keeps continuous, real-time records of goods bought and sold, updating inventory accounts without physical counts.
Journal entry
A record in accounting that documents a business transaction and its impact on the company's accounts, using debits and credits.
Cost of merchandise sold
The total expense incurred by a company to buy or manufacture the goods sold during a given period.
